ASEAN vehicle sales rise 10% in Q1
New vehicle sales in South-east Asia's six largest markets increased by 10.5% to 823,565 units in the first quarter of 2017, from 745,242 units in the same period of the previous year, according to data collected by AsiaMotorBusiness.com exclusively for just-auto. -

South Korean domestic sales fall 5% in April
Domestic sales by South Korea's five main automakers fell by 5% to 132,675 units in April 2017, from 139,617 units in the same month of last year, according to preliminary data released individually by the country's vehicle manufacturers. -

Dana boosts Q1 sales 17%
Dana boosted first quarter 2017 sales to US$1.70bn, compared with $1.45bn in Q1 2016, a 17% increase. The increase was due to new business gains, higher demand in global light truck markets, and improved demand for global off highway components. -
